The Redmi brand is synonymous with quality budget phones, offering plenty of bang for your buck. We've already seen the Redmi 8 and Redmi Note 8 series in the second half of 2019, but it looks like we could get more devices very soon.
Xiaomi global vice-president Manu Kumar Jain has teased the imminent launch of new Redmi devices on Twitter. We also get a video that doesn't tell us much, save for the fact that the devices are "coming soon."

The tweet and video clearly don't give us many clues, but February 2019 saw the Indian launch of the Redmi Note 7 series. Going by this timetable, we therefore expect the Xiaomi sub-brand to launch the Redmi Note 9 family.
We're not quite sure what to expect from the Redmi Note 9 series, but the Redmi Note 8 offered a 48MP quad rear camera setup and a Snapdragon 665 processor. Meanwhile, the Pro model delivered a 64MP quad rear camera combo and Helio G90T processor.
We also saw the Redmi 7 series launching in China back in March 2019, before coming to India in April 2019. So there's a chance we could see the Redmi 9 series — either as part of the Note family launch or on its own.
91Mobiles reported that the Redmi 9 will offer the new MediaTek Helio G70 processor, citing industry sources. This would make for a major upgrade over the Redmi 8's Snapdragon 439 chipset, offering more powerful CPU cores and a better GPU.
